unsigned short TreeScope::comparePosition(const TreeScope& otherScope) const
{
if (otherScope == this)
return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_EQUIVALENT;
Vector<const TreeScope*, 16> chain1;
Vector<const TreeScope*, 16> chain2;
const TreeScope* current;
for (current = this; current; current = current->parentTreeScope())
chain1.append(current);
for (current = &otherScope; current; current = current->parentTreeScope())
chain2.append(current);
unsigned index1 = chain1.size();
unsigned index2 = chain2.size();
if (chain1[index1 - 1] != chain2[index2 - 1])
return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_DISCONNECTED |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_IMPLEMENTATION_SPECIFIC;
for (unsigned i = std::min(index1, index2); i; --i) {
const TreeScope* child1 = chain1[--index1];
const TreeScope* child2 = chain2[--index2];
if (child1 != child2) {
Node* shadowHost1 = child1->rootNode().parentOrShadowHostNode();
Node* shadowHost2 = child2->rootNode().parentOrShadowHostNode();
if (shadowHost1 != shadowHost2)
return shadowHost1->compareDocumentPosition(shadowHost2, Node::TreatShadowTreesAsDisconnected);
for (const ShadowRoot* child = toShadowRoot(child2->rootNode()).olderShadowRoot(); child; child = child->olderShadowRoot())
if (child == child1)
return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_FOLLOWING;
return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_PRECEDING;
}
}
// There was no difference between the two parent chains, i.e., one was a subset of the other. The shorter
// chain is the ancestor.
return index1 < index2 ?
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_FOLLOWING |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_CONTAINED_BY :
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_PRECEDING | Node::DOCUMENT_POSITION_CONTAINS;
}
const TreeScope* TreeScope::commonAncestorTreeScope(const TreeScope& other) const
{
Vector<const TreeScope*, 16> thisChain;
for (const TreeScope* tree = this; tree; tree = tree->parentTreeScope())
thisChain.append(tree);
Vector<const TreeScope*, 16> otherChain;
for (const TreeScope* tree = &other; tree; tree = tree->parentTreeScope())
otherChain.append(tree);
// Keep popping out the last elements of these chains until a mismatched pair is found. If |this| and |other|
// belong to different documents, null will be returned.
const TreeScope* lastAncestor = 0;
while (!thisChain.isEmpty() && !otherChain.isEmpty() && thisChain.last() == otherChain.last()) {
lastAncestor = thisChain.last();
thisChain.removeLast();
otherChain.removeLast();
}
return lastAncestor;
}
